Microsoft’s Yusuf Mehdi has released a statement in an interview to Bloomberg Tech stating that 300 million users are using the latest Windows 10 Operating System every day for approx 3.5 hours a day. Windows 10 is now on 400 Million active devices worldwide.

Mehdi also spoke about Microsoft’s New version of Windows 10 S stating that Microsoft is yet to receive any positive response on the new version of the Operating System while stating some of the benefits of Windows 10 S over its competitor Google ChromeBooks which gives users access to Full Office, Ability to Work Offline, Virtual Reality and more.

He also pointed out that with Windows 10 S users get the apps that come from the Windows Store which brings safety, security and performance of the apps on Windows 10 S. He also said that the company is going to announce the updated number of active users on Windows 10 S at the Build 2017 Next week.
